Carbohydrates are among the 3 groups of "macronutrients" that everybody's knowledgeable about; the other 2 are fat and protein (mediterranean keto diet). Most carbs are transformed in the body to glucose, a type of sugar, to be used for energy or kept as fat. The exception is fiber, which can't be absorbed or broken down into sugar by the body.

Soluble fiber, which liquifies in water, is used by the body to manage the glucose that gets in the bloodstream when carbohydrates are broken down (mediterranean keto diet). Insoluble fiber helps with digestion and prevents constipation. Why was it important to go into information about fiber? When you look at a keto food list or the labels on packaged food, you'll frequently see two numbers listed under the heading of "carbs": overall carbohydrates and net carbohydrates.

Some labels will just note total carbohydrates and "carbohydrates from fiber (keto plus diet)." In that case, deduct the second number from the first to compute the net carbohydrates for that food. Again, net carbs is the essential number to look at when you're on a ketogenic diet. Unfortunately, there's not a basic answer. Here's why. As you now understand, the keto diet plan limits the quantity of net carbs you can consume, and not the quantity of overall carbs.

So the guidelines generally call for a diet composed of 75% fat, 20% protein and 5% carbs, not specific numbers of carbs or specific weights of proteins. Everybody is various (mediterranean keto diet). Not just do most males need more calories than women, but building workers or pro professional athletes are going to require more calories (and more food) than sedentary stay-at-home parents or office workers.
